Gas Stations in Grand Falls-Windsor, NL
Find accurate info on the best gas stations in Grand Falls-Windsor. Get reviews and contact details for each business, including phone number, address, opening hours, promotions and other information.
Showing results: 1 - 12 out of 12
Showing results: 1 - 12 out of 12
Results from the 'Gas Stations' category in Grand Falls-Windsor

Closed now
54 Hardy Avenue, Grand Falls-Windsor, A2A 2T9
(709) 489-0484



Closed now
41 Union Street, Grand Falls-Windsor, A2A 2C9
(709) 489-8812


Closed now
47 Queensway, Grand Falls-Windsor, A2B 1K9
(709) 489-9003


Closed now
6 Cromer Avenue, Grand Falls-Windsor, A2A 1X2
(709) 489-6712


Open now
41 Union Street, Grand Falls-Windsor, A2A 2C9
(709) 489-8812


Closed now
103 Lincoln Rd, Grand Falls-Windsor, A2A 1P3
(709) 489-7211


Closed now
129 Lincoln Road #127, Grand Falls-Windsor, A2A 1P3
709-489-7900


40 High Street, Grand Falls-Windsor, A2A 1C6
709-489-2822
